Fix windows #11
clippy
7 warnings
Details
Results
Message level | Amount |
---|---|
Internal compiler error | 0 |
Error | 0 |
Warning | 7 |
Note | 0 |
Help | 0 |
Versions
- rustc 1.74.0 (79e9716c9 2023-11-13)
- cargo 1.74.0 (ecb9851af 2023-10-18)
- clippy 0.1.74 (79e9716 2023-11-13)
Annotations
Check warning on line 179 in theseus_cli/src/subcommands/profile.rs
github-actions / clippy
unnecessarily eager cloning of iterator items
warning: unnecessarily eager cloning of iterator items
--> theseus_cli/src/subcommands/profile.rs:179:17
|
179 | loaders.iter().cloned().find(filter).ok_or_else(|| {
| ^^^^^^^^^^^^^^----------------------
| |
| help: try: `.find(|&x| filter(x)).cloned()`
|
= help: for further information visit https://rust-lang.github.io/rust-clippy/master/index.html#iter_overeager_cloned
= note: `#[warn(clippy::iter_overeager_cloned)]` on by default
Check warning on line 180 in theseus/src/launcher/mod.rs
github-actions / clippy
the borrowed expression implements the required traits
warning: the borrowed expression implements the required traits
--> theseus/src/launcher/mod.rs:180:27
|
180 | &io::canonicalize(&profile.get_profile_full_path().await?)?;
| 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 help: change this to: `profile.get_profile_full_path().await?`
|
= help: for further information visit https://rust-lang.github.io/rust-clippy/master/index.html#needless_borrows_for_generic_args
= note: `#[warn(clippy::needless_borrows_for_generic_args)]` on by default
Check warning on line 276 in theseus/src/api/profile/create.rs
github-actions / clippy
unnecessarily eager cloning of iterator items
warning: unnecessarily eager cloning of iterator items
--> theseus/src/api/profile/create.rs:273:26
|
273 | let loader_version = loaders
| ___________________________^
274 | | .iter()
| | ________________-
275 | || .cloned()
276 | || .find(filter)
| ||_____________________^
| |_____________________|
| help: try: `.find(|&x| filter(x)).cloned()`
|
= help: for further information visit https://rust-lang.github.io/rust-clippy/master/index.html#iter_overeager_cloned
= note: `#[warn(clippy::iter_overeager_cloned)]` on by default
Check warning on line 46 in theseus/src/launcher/auth.rs
github-actions / clippy
function `refresh_credentials` is never used
warning: function `refresh_credentials` is never used
--> theseus/src/launcher/auth.rs:46:14
|
46 | pub async fn refresh_credentials(
| ^^^^^^^^^^^^^^^^^^^
|
= note: `#[warn(dead_code)]` on by default
Check warning on line 41 in theseus/src/api/auth.rs
github-actions / clippy
variable does not need to be mutable
warning: variable does not need to be mutable
--> theseus/src/api/auth.rs:41:9
|
41 | let mut users = state.users.write().await;
| ----^^^^^
| |
| help: remove this `mut`
|
= note: `#[warn(unused_mut)]` on by default
Check warning on line 3 in theseus/src/api/hydra/complete.rs
github-actions / clippy
braces around Deserialize is unnecessary
warning: braces around Deserialize is unnecessary
--> theseus/src/api/hydra/complete.rs:3:1
|
3 | use serde::{Deserialize};
| ^^^^^^^^^^^^^^^^^^^^^^^^^
|
note: the lint level is defined here
--> theseus/src/lib.rs:7:9
|
7 | #![warn(unused_import_braces)]
| ^^^^^^^^^^^^^^^^^^^^
Check warning on line 3 in theseus/src/api/auth.rs
github-actions / clippy
unused import: `self`
warning: unused import: `self`
--> theseus/src/api/auth.rs:3:13
|
3 | hydra::{self, init::DeviceLoginSuccess},
| ^^^^
|
= note: `#[warn(unused_imports)]` on by default